१५ दिन-मुहूर्त — 15 Day-Muhūrtas (Sūrya-Siddhānta)

Each Muhūrta = 2 Ghaṭikās = 48 minutes. There are 30 Muhūrtas in the full day-night cycle (15 + 15).

अयनांश — Multi-Ayanāṁśa Comparison

Different Vedic schools use different ayanāṁśa anchors. For cuspal placements (planets near sign-boundaries), the ayanāṁśa choice determines which sign the planet falls in.
